A crime scene. A murder. A mystery. The most important person on the scene? The forensic scientist. And yet the intricate details of their work remains a mystery to most of us. Silent Witnesses looks at the history of forensic science over the last two centuries, during which time a combination of remarkable intuition, painstaking observation, and leaps in scientific knowledge have developed this fascinating branch of detection. Throwing open the casebook, it introduces us to such luminaries as ‘The Wizard of Berkeley’ Edward Heinrich, who is credited with having solved over 2,000 crimes, and Alphonse Bertillon, the French scientist whose guiding principle ‘no two individuals share the same characteristics’ became the core of identification. Along the way, it takes us to India and Australia, Columbia and China, Russia, France, Germany, Spain, and Italy. And it proves that, in order to solve ever more complicated cases, science must always stay one step ahead of the killer.

Nigel McCrery has had an interesting career – an ex-policeman turned screenwriter, he’s the man behind such successful TV dramas as Silent Witness and New Tricks, and has also written several crime novels. All of which makes him perhaps the ideal person to write a book on the history of the contribution of forensic science to crime detection.
Each chapter looks at a different aspect of forensics – ballistics, blood, fingerprinting, the human body, DNA etc. McCrery introduces us to the scientists and detectives who developed the techniques and tests that gradually led to the current state of play where forensics is one of the major planks of detection. In less skilled hands, this could be a very dry subject indeed, but McCrery writes flowingly and interestingly, making the people come to life and explaining the science in a way that is easy to understand.
What makes the book most interesting is that McCrery tells the stories of the true crimes that were the earliest to be solved by each individual technique, and he ranges widely across the world to do so. He takes us back in time to the earliest days of detection to give a picture of the primitive, sometimes barbaric, methods that were used prior to the development of scientific methods – so we learn, for instance, of the suspect forced to share a bed with the bodies of his supposed victims to see if guilt would produce a confession. Or how about the early method of identifying an unknown victim by sticking the head on a pole and displaying it in public?
McCrery uses a chronological approach to telling his story, so in the chapter on the gun, for instance, we learn about its history from its earliest appearance as a Chinese ‘fire-lance’, through the invention of flintlocks and on to revolvers.
Silent Witnesses is an easily accessible and well-written primer on the history of forensic science. It reads like a work of fiction but offers the reader a clear history of many of the most important advances in forensic investigative techniques. The topics are covered in chapters titled: Identity, Ballistics, Blood, Trace Evidence, The Body, Poisons, and DNA. Each subject is reviewed chronologically and numerous milestone cases in the development and growth of forensic science are presented.
For example, in the Identity chapter, the war between Alphonse Bertillon and his anthropometric ID system known as “bertillonage” and those who favored fingerprinting as the gold standard for identification of an individual is documented. In Blood, the development of the ABO blood typing system is well presented as well as the methods for identifying a stain as blood and determining that it is human and not animal, both extremely important in crimes where blood is shed. In Trace Evidence, the discovery and development of the microscope as a forensic tool is covered in great detail. Poisons have been around almost as long as civilization and in the chapter Poisons this long and sordid history is chronicled as are the steps in the creation of the fascinating field of forensic toxicology, including the development of the famous Marsh and Reinsch tests for identifying the “inheritance powder” arsenic.
Perhaps the most enjoyable parts of Silent Witnesses are the discussions of famous cases that helped develop forensic science as a viable entity. Silent Witnesses opens with the famous Colin Pitchfork case—-the first time DNA profiling was used to solve a murder.
